Transaction ec7600d975e4bdc839618974343a06ae3178df2f1d29fae4c0b89c99ea36cf73
1 Input
1 Output
-
ec7600d975e4bdc839618974343a06ae3178df2f1d29fae4c0b89c99ea36cf73:0
- value
- 512773
- script pubkey
- OP_0 OP_PUSHBYTES_20 52613dc7e5b931692493e36ee65f03df90c52ccb
- address
- bc1q2fsnm3l9hyckjfynudhwvhcrm7gv2txtamlyxt